Practical guide to solve high failure rate and short service life problems
1. Do not fasten the lid tightly right after use, dry the internal moisture first
How to operate: After each cooking, after cleaning the inner pot and lid, do not directly lock the lid for sealing. You can either place it upside down on the pot, or stand it in a ventilated place to air dry for 1-2 hours, and store it only after the moisture in the lid gaps and inside the cooker body is completely evaporated. Why it works: 60% of startup failures are not caused by you splashing water on the cooker, but by cooking steam entering the mainboard compartment through gaps, condensing into water and accumulating inside, which rusts through the circuit over time. Drying the moisture can avoid 90% of non-human-induced mainboard damage.
2. Remove and clean the sealing ring once a month, do not pull it hard
How to operate: Gently pry the sealing ring out along the clamping slot, wash off the rice grains and soup scale stuck in the gaps with dish soap, wipe it dry and install it back along the slot. If you find small cracks, or it feels sticky and deformed, replace it with a new sealing ring of the same model in time, do not make do with a damaged one. Why it works: Food residues stuck in the gaps will wear out the sealing ring and cause steam leakage on one hand, and on the other hand, when the pot boils over, soup can easily flow into the cooker body along the gaps and burn out the heating plate.
3. Do not wash rice with the inner pot, do not throw hard frozen chunks into it
How to operate: Wash rice in a separate basin, do not use the stainless steel inner pot to wash rice directly, and do not throw frozen hard ribs or ice chunks directly into the pot which may hit and damage the inner pot. Place ingredients gently when putting them in. Why it works: If the bottom of the inner pot is deformed by impact, it will not fit tightly with the heating plate, which will cause local overheating during heating, and it is very easy to burn out the heating wire. A deformed inner pot will also lead to loose sealing, accelerating the wear of the sealing ring.
How to avoid high failure rate and short service life problems when purchasing?
Focus on 3 core indicators, it is worth spending a little extra money
- Prioritize models with stainless steel heating plates, do not choose alloy heating plates with very thin plating. Weigh the cooker body, too light models are mostly jerry-built internally, with thin shells and poor-quality accessories, which are easy to deform after long-term use.
- Choose models with a waterproof coating on the main control board. Many reliable products now spray a layer of nano waterproof coating on the mainboard, which will not cause short circuit even if a small amount of steam enters occasionally. This design only adds around $3-$5 to the cost, but can extend the service life by at least 2 years.
- Choose a sealing ring made of food-grade silicone rubber that feels tough, not soft or sticky. Do not choose ones that feel hard and have a strange smell.
Pitfall avoidance list: do not trust these marketing slogans
- Do not trust “ultra-light and ultra-thin design”: The weight of a pressure cooker is directly related to the thickness of the materials used. Too light models must use thinner steel plates and have cut corners on core components, which will deform soon after use.
- Do not trust “no need to replace the sealing ring for life”: The sealing ring is a consumable. No matter how good the material is, it will age after 2-3 years of use. Anyone who says this is misleading consumers.
- Do not buy miscellaneous models with vague descriptions of material and rated power on the product nameplate. They are mostly assembled by small workshops, have no safety testing, and you can not even find after-sales service when they break down.
Summary
How long a pressure cooker can be used depends 30% on selection and 70% on maintenance. When purchasing, focus on the three core points: waterproof mainboard, stainless steel heating plate, and qualified sealing ring. If you pay attention to drying moisture and cleaning accessories regularly in daily use, it is really easy to use it for more than 5 years.
